The test calls ArrayBuffer.prototype.transfer() on the Buffer pool's
backing ArrayBuffer and expects a TypeError. On the V8 shipped with
Electron 40's Chromium, this code path hits a "v8::FromJust Maybe
value is Nothing" fatal error inside ArrayBufferTransfer instead of
throwing — a V8 bug that was fixed in a newer V8 revision (the test
passes on main/42). This Electron line can't pick up that fix, so
skip the test.

BUILD.gn previously hard-coded read_file(".git/packed-refs", ...) and
".git/HEAD" to derive electron_version. In a `git worktree` checkout
.git is a file containing a gitdir: pointer, not a directory, so GN's
read_file() fails and gn gen aborts unless override_electron_version is
set manually.
Ask git itself for the real locations via `git rev-parse --git-dir` /
`--git-common-dir` in a small helper script, and feed those resolved
paths to read_file() and the exec_script dependency list. Behaviour in
a plain clone is unchanged (both resolve to electron/.git/...), and the
tarball case still fails loudly with a pointer to
override_electron_version.

build: derive patches upstream-head ref from script path (#50727)
* build: derive patches upstream-head ref from script path
gclient-new-workdir.py symlinks each repo's .git/refs back to the source
checkout, so the fixed refs/patches/upstream-head was shared across all
worktrees. Parallel `e sync` runs in different worktrees clobbered each
other's upstream-head, breaking `e patches` and check-patch-diff.
Suffix the ref with an md5 of the script directory so each worktree writes
a distinct ref into the shared refs dir. Fall back to the legacy ref name
in guess_base_commit so existing checkouts keep working until next sync.

git format-patch honors diff.renames, which defaults to 'true' (rename
detection only). If a user has diff.renames=copies configured at the
system or global level, exported patches may encode new files as copies
of similar existing files, causing spurious diffs against patches
exported on other machines. Pin diff.renames=true to match git's
default.

* chore: bump nan to 2.23.0
* Fix C++ flags passed to C compiler in NAN spec runner
Passing C++-specific flags to the C compiler caused failures building native test modules.
NAN uprgaded the version of node-gyp it uses, triggering a new codepath with the C compiler that didn't occur before. In that new branch, the C++ flags present in the CFLAGS environment variable we were passing in caused the C compiler to error out:
```
error: invalid argument '-std=c++20' not allowed with 'C'
```
The fix is to only pass C++-specific flags to the C++ compiler, and not the C compiler. This is done by separating out the CFLAGS and CXXFLAGS environment variables in our nan-spec-runner.js script.
